Associate an Existing Place Tag Action to a Safety Document
1. With no switching sheet or safety document in record mode, find an asset that can have a HOLD condition.
2. Double-click the asset to launch the Control Tool.
3. Select Place Hold Tag from the Tag... menu's Hold Tags submenu. A Hold Tag step is recorded into the Miscellaneous Log.
4. Create a HOLD safety document.
5. Load the Miscellaneous Log and refresh the list so that the Place Hold Tag step is displayed.
6. Select the Place Hold Tag step. Click the Cut Step button () to cut the step.
7. Go back to the newly created Hold Safety document and click the Paste button (). The asset associated to the Place Hold Tag step is displayed in the safety document's Tag Points list. The safety document can now be issued.
Note: If you attempt to add a step action association that is not valid for the safety document type, an error message will be displayed. For example, you would get an error if you attempted to add a step action for a Place Hold Tag into a Clearance document.
